NetWorker : keytool error : java.io.IOException : Le magasin de clés a été altéré ou le mot de passe était incorrect »

Summary: La commande keytool NetWorker Runtime Environment (NRE) renvoie l’erreur suivante lors de la tentative d’accès au fichier cacerts NRE « keytool error : java.io.IOException : Le magasin de clés a été altéré ou le mot de passe était incorrect. » ...

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

NetWorker Runtime Environment (NRE) comprend un keytool Utilitaire utilisé pour gérer plusieurs fichiers de magasin de clés et de magasin de confiance.
Le keytool renvoie l’erreur suivante lorsqu’elle est utilisée pour gérer le fichier cacerts NRE :

# /opt/nre/java/latest/bin/keytool -list -keystore /opt/nre/java/latest/lib/security/cacerts -storepass 'password'
keytool error: java.io.IOException: Keystore was tampered with, or password was incorrect

Cause

Ce problème peut être dû à l’utilisation d’un mot de passe de magasin de clés incorrect lors de la tentative d’exécution de keytool . Par exemple, le mot de passe du magasin de clés du NetWorker Authentication Server (AUTHC) a été utilisé avec le keytool commande au lieu des cacerts NRE par défaut

Resolution

Le mot de passe du magasin de clés Java n’est pas le même mot de passe du magasin de clés AUTHC que celui défini lors de l’installation de NetWorker, mais plutôt le mot de passe du magasin de clés JAVA. Le mot de passe par défaut est changeit.

Exemple Linux :
[root@nsr ~]# /opt/nre/java/latest/bin/keytool -list -keystore /opt/nre/java/latest/lib/security/cacerts -storepass changeit | grep emcauthctomcat
emcauthctomcat, Aug 19, 2025, trustedCertEntry,

Exemple Windows :

C:\Program Files\NRE\java\jre1.8.0_411\bin>keytool.exe -list -keystore ..\lib\security\cacerts -storepass changeit | findstr emcauthctomcat
emcauthctomcat, Sep 5, 2025, trustedCertEntry,
Remarque : Comme la sortie de cette commande peut être longue, l’exemple ci-dessusutilise les commandes du système d’exploitation, grep (Linux) et findstr (Windows) pour filtrer le certificat NetWorker AUTHC tomcat local. Sur les hôtes Windows, le chemin d’accès au répertoire bin Java varie en fonction de la version NRE installée.

Additional Information

Remarque : La commande keytool est utilisée pour gérer les certificats d’autorité de certification importés dans NRE. Ceci est requis lors de l’intégration de l’authentification LDAPS (Secure Lightweight Directory Access Protocol) avec NetWorker : NetWorker : Configuration de l’authentification LDAPS

Si NetWorker Runtime Environment (NRE) est installé, le dossier Java Runtime Environment (JRE) se trouve :

  • Linux : /opt/nre/java/latest
  • Windows. : C:\Program Files\NRE\java\jre#.#.#_#


Oracle Java Runtime Environment (JRE) est disponible à l’adresse suivante :

  • Linux :  /usr/java/latest 
  • Windows. : C:\Program Files\Java (Vous devez sélectionner le dossier de la dernière version)

Affected Products

NetWorker

Products

NetWorker Family
Article Properties
Article Number: 000038944
Article Type: Solution
Last Modified: 11 Sept 2025
Version:  5
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.